AMERICAN CAPITAL INVESTS $32.2 MILLION TO SPONSOR ACQUISITION
OF SPECIALTY VEHICLE MANUFACTURER FROM INTERMET

Bethesda, MD -- American Capital Strategies, Ltd. (Nasdaq:ACAS) announced today that an acquisition company controlled by American Capital has acquired Iowa Mold Tooling Co., Inc. from Intermet Corporation (Nasdaq:INMT). IMT is a leading manufacturer of service vehicles, material handling systems and specialty cranes serving the tire, mining, construction, material handling, equipment dealer, railroad and utility markets throughout the world. American Capital provided $32,200,000 in junior capital, consisting of senior subordinated debt with warrants, junior subordinated debt with warrants and common equity. Other equity capital was provided by members of the senior management team of IMT and from Mobile Tool International, an American Capital portfolio company. GMAC Business Credit provided a $31,000,000 senior credit facility. American Capital will have majority control of IMT.

American Capital is a publicly traded buyout and mezzanine fund. American Capital is an equity partner in management and employee buyouts; invests in debt and equity of companies led by private equity firms, and provides capital directly to private and small public companies. American Capital funds growth, acquisitions and recapitalizations.

GMAC Business Credit is a leading national provider of senior loans to middle market companies such as IMT. It offers a full line of financing products, including cash-flow and asset-based loans.
